服务器集群:热备策略保障高可用

服务器集群服务器热备

时间:2024-11-09 09:58


服务器集群中的服务器热备:构建高可用性的坚实基石 在当今这个信息化、数字化飞速发展的时代,服务器作为数据存储与处理的核心设备,其稳定性和可靠性直接关系到业务的连续性和客户体验

    随着企业业务的不断扩展和复杂化,对服务器的性能、安全性以及容错能力提出了更高要求

    在这样的背景下,服务器集群技术应运而生,而其中的服务器热备机制更是成为了保障系统高可用性、实现业务连续性不可或缺的一环

     一、服务器集群概述 服务器集群,简而言之,就是将多台服务器通过网络连接起来,共同对外提供服务的一种系统架构

    这种架构通过负载均衡、资源共享、故障转移等技术手段,实现了服务的高可用性、可扩展性和灵活性

    服务器集群能够有效分散单一服务器的压力,避免因单点故障导致整个系统崩溃,从而确保业务的连续稳定运行

     二、服务器热备的定义与重要性 服务器热备,是指在服务器集群中,配置一台或多台备用服务器(热备服务器),这些服务器在正常情况下不直接参与业务处理,但始终保持运行状态,并实时监控主服务器的状态

    一旦主服务器发生故障,热备服务器能够迅速接管其工作,确保服务不中断,用户几乎感受不到任何影响

    这种机制对于保障关键业务系统的连续性至关重要,特别是在金融、医疗、电商等对服务连续性要求极高的行业中,服务器热备几乎成为了标配

     重要性分析 1.业务连续性保障:服务器热备最直接的作用是确保业务连续性,即使主服务器遭遇硬件故障、软件错误或网络中断等问题,也能通过快速切换至热备服务器,使服务几乎无缝继续,减少因停机造成的损失

     2.提升用户体验:对于用户而言,服务的连续性和稳定性是评价服务质量的重要指标

    服务器热备机制能够显著降低服务中断的概率,提升用户体验,增强用户信任

     3.数据安全性增强:在热备机制下,主服务器与热备服务器之间通常会有数据同步机制,确保数据的实时备份

    这样即使主服务器数据受损,也能从热备服务器中恢复,保护企业数据资产不受损失

     4.资源优化利用:虽然热备服务器在常态下不直接参与业务处理,但其作为“待命”状态的存在,使得集群整体资源得到更加合理的分配和利用,提高了整体系统的效率

     三、服务器热备的实现方式 服务器热备的实现方式多种多样,根据具体需求和技术选型,可以分为以下几种主要模式: 1.主从备份模式:这是最基础的热备模式,其中一台服务器作为主服务器处理业务,另一台作为从服务器(热备服务器)保持同步并随时准备接管

    这种模式简单直接,但资源利用率相对较低

     2.双主备份模式:也称为双活模式,两台服务器都参与业务处理,同时互为热备

    这种模式提高了资源利用率,但实现起来较为复杂,需要良好的负载均衡和冲突解决机制

     3.集群热备模式:在大型服务器集群中,可能有多台热备服务器,通过集群管理软件实现自动故障检测和切换

    这种模式灵活性强,适用于大规模、高并发的应用场景

     4.虚拟化热备:随着虚拟化技术的发展,虚拟机热迁移和热备成为可能

    通过虚拟化平台,可以更容易地实现服务器的快速切换和资源动态调整

     四、实施服务器热备的关键要素 1.故障检测与切换机制:高效、准确的故障检测是热备机制的前提,而快速的切换能力则是确保服务连续性的关键

    这依赖于先进的监控系统和自动化切换工具

     2.数据同步与一致性:确保主服务器与热备服务器之间的数据实时、一致是热备机制有效运行的基础

    这通常需要采用数据库复制、文件同步等技术手段

     3.资源规划与分配:合理规划服务器资源,包括CPU、内存、存储等,确保热备服务器在接管业务时能够满足性能需求,同时避免资源浪费

     4.测试与演练:定期进行热备切换测试和业务连续性演练,验证热备机制的有效性,及时发现并解决问题,提升应急响应能力

     5.安全与合规性:在实施热备机制时,还需考虑数据的安全性和合规性要求,确保数据传输、存储和处理符合相关法律法规和行业标准

     五、未来展望 随着云计算、大数据、人工智能等技术的快速发展,服务器集群和热备机制也在不断创新和完